RCW 66.24.530 — Duty free exporter's license—Class S—Fee.
- (1) There shall be a license to be designated as a class S license to qualified duty free exporters authorizing such exporters to sell beer and wine to vessels for consumption outside the state of Washington.
(2) To qualify for a license under subsection (1) of this section, the exporter shall have:
- (a) An importer's basic permit issued by the United States bureau of alcohol, tobacco, and firearms and a customs house license in conjunction with a common carriers bond;
- (b) A customs bonded warehouse, or be able to operate from a foreign trade zone; and
- (c) A notarized signed statement from the purchaser stating that the product is for consumption outside the state of Washington.
- (3) The license for qualified duty free exporters shall authorize the duty free exporter to purchase from a brewery, winery, beer wholesaler, wine wholesaler, beer importer, or wine importer licensed by the state of Washington.
- (4) Beer and/or wine sold and delivered in this state to duty free exporters for use under this section shall be considered exported from the state.
- (5) The fee for this license shall be $150 per annum.
